Key Responsibilities:
- Monitor mechanical plant
- Pumps, Motors, Seals, Bearings
- Air Conditioning - Air Handling Units / Fan Coil Unit (Filter changes, cleaning)
- Water Treatment (Temperature checks / Not dosing)
- General building fabric
- Escort specialist sub contractors
- General building fabric
- Undertake repairs to HVAC Plant and Associated Systems to a high standard.
- Undertake installation, alteration and repairs to pipework systems as needed.
- Undertake all allocated tasks and perform them in a timely and professional manner.
- Be proactive in identifying and reporting faults with building services equipment and take steps to resolve them.
- Be proactive to ensure all H&S issues are reported/escalated as required.
- Maintain informal communications with Client staff members related to service levels and issues.
- Report service affecting issued to the site management team for formal communication with the client.
- Remain flexible with regard to site attendance and tasks undertaken within personal competency.
- Be fully aware of relevant Health and Safety and general legislative matters.
